Course Details

Nutritional Foundations for Children's Joint Health: Understanding essential nutrients, vitamins, and minerals for optimal joint health in children. • Child-Friendly Recipes for Joint Health: Exploring delicious and kid-approved recipes that promote joint health. • Smart Shopping for Joint-Friendly Ingredients: Identifying high-quality, joint-friendly ingredients and where to find them. • Food Allergies and Intolerances in Children: Recognizing common food allergies and intolerances in children and their impact on joint health. • Menu Planning and Portion Control: Strategies for creating well-balanced, portion-controlled meals for children. • Cooking Techniques for Nutrient Preservation: Mastering cooking techniques that preserve maximum nutrients, enhancing children's joint health. • Incorporating Whole Foods and Plant-Based Options: Expanding culinary skills to include whole foods and plant-based options for joint health. • Engaging Children in the Kitchen: Encouraging children to participate in meal preparation, fostering a positive relationship with food. • Food Safety and Hygiene for Young Chefs: Ensuring a safe and hygienic cooking environment for children.
